One of my users is getting an error when they try to connect to an Analysis server. The error message is:
'Microsoft.AnalysisServices.AdomdClient.NamespacesMgr' threw and exception.
Does anyone know the cause of it and how to fix it?
Solved! Go to Solution.
We found the cause. It had to do with the user id and admin settings on the server side. Roles and perms.

Do you connect to SSAS from Power BI Desktop or Power BI Service? If you use Power BI Desktop, what option do you use? “Import” or “Connect live”? We also need to know what version and edition of SSAS you connect to.
I have just tested connecting to SSAS using import and connect live options in Power BI Desktop, everything works well. I found a thread stating similar issue, it is related to profile, and the issue is solved after removing Power BI desktop folder in the user profile (APPDATA\local\microsoft\PowerBI Desktop) and restarting Power BI Desktop.
